4. Recently, the Hon'ble Supreme Courr n Raiendra Kumar Barjatga v, U,P. Aoas Euam Vikas Parishadt, in the larger public interest, issued directions irr Lddil.ion to the I 2024 SCC Onlinc SC i767 3 directives issued in Re: Directions in the maffer of demotition of structures. Relevant for the purpose of this case are: "(iv) A1l the necessary service connections, such as, trlectricity, rtatcr supply, se\r,eragc uonnection, etc., shall be gir.en by the seruice provider / Board to the buildings only after the production ol the completion / occupalion cerLificate. (v) trven after .issuance of completion certificate, deviation / vrolation if any contrary to the planning permission brought to the notice ol the aulhoriry immediate steps be taken by the said authority concerned, in accordance u,ith law, against [he builder / or,,,,ner / occupant; and the official, who is responsiblc for issuance of wror-rgful c-.mpietion / occupation certificate shall be proqeeded departmcntally furthwit h. (vi) No permission / licence to conduct any business / trade mlrsl bc givcn by any authorities including local bodies of States / Union Territories in any unauthorised building irrespective of it being residential or commercial building. (vii) The development must be in conformity with the zonal plan land usage. Any modilication to such zonal plan and usage must be taken by strictly following the rules in place land in consideration of the larger public interest and the impact on the environment".

5. Since the prayer of petitioners is to release individua-l service connections, this Court without going into merits of 4 the matter, dirc.:ts the lespondents to re ( ase indivtdual service connections to the subject prope r J/ subject to petitioners complying with the directions ssued bv the Honble Supreme Court in Rajendra Kumar I faryatga's casc (supra) ancl the statutory requirements prescri red by the local authoritie s

6. The Writ Petition is accordingly, dispose I of. No costs 7 .
